The versatility of fiberglass water containers makes them suitable for a wide range of applications. They are commonly used in residential settings for garden irrigation and drinking water storage, as well as in commercial and industrial environments for agricultural use, construction sites, and emergency preparedness. Their robust construction and flexible design allow them to be tailored to various capacities and configurations, further enhancing their usability in diverse contexts.

  • Firstly, red bollards play an essential role in traffic management. Positioned strategically along roadways, pedestrian walkways, and busy intersections, these fixtures help delineate spaces, ensuring that vehicles and pedestrians navigate safely in increasingly crowded urban areas. The bright red color of these bollards is not merely decorative; it serves a critical safety function. The bold hue draws attention, signaling to drivers to slow down and be vigilant of the proximity to pedestrian zones. In places where traffic flow needs to be controlled, red bollards act as a deterrent, preventing unauthorized vehicle access to specific areas, thereby enhancing pedestrian safety.

  • Design considerations also play a significant role in their effectiveness. For instance, the shape of the cover should ideally be round, as this prevents the cover from falling into the opening—a risk associated with square or rectangular covers. Additionally, features such as lifting points, ventilation holes, and locking mechanisms can enhance usability and security.

  • There are various types of bike racks available to meet the needs of different environments. From traditional U-shaped racks to more innovative designs like vertical and wave racks, each has its advantages. U-shaped racks are popular because they allow cyclists to secure both the frame and wheels of the bike to the rack with a lock. Vertical racks, on the other hand, maximize space, making them ideal for areas with limited room. Wave racks provide a unique aesthetic appeal while accommodating multiple bikes at once. The choice of bike rack design should take into account the specific needs of the location and the volume of cyclists.

  • The valve typically consists of a body, a blade (or gate), a seat, and an actuator. The blade is operated via a handwheel, pneumatic actuator, or electric actuator, allowing for manual or automated control. The simplicity of the design enables fewer moving parts, which can reduce maintenance needs and improve reliability in demanding environments.
